NKF: National Kidney Federation

Summary

Run by patients for patients, the National Kidney Federation promotes the interests of kidney patients throughout the UK to the government and media. It campaigns for improvements to renal provision and treatment and provides national support services through its helpline and advocacy, information leaflets and quarterly reports. The NKF continues to forge closer relationships with other kidney charities to ensure that resource is used effectively and that different groups don’t keep reinventing the same wheel. A large number of kidney patients come from ethnic backgrounds and this presents separate difficulties which have to be faced, translation of leaflets, involvement in the patient organisations, shortages of donor organs, cultural views toward transplantation. The Kidney Patient Associations (KPAs) themselves need strengthening and in the coming years the NKF intends to focus on providing real help to these groups of patients who are struggling to maintain their local service within their own units.
